BGP-based inter-domain traffic engineering in BGP/MPLS VPNs

In BGP/MPLS VPNs, traffic engineering (TE) achieved by using multiprotocol label switching (MPLS) was predominantly limited to ultra-domain and single administrative domain. However with the rapid expansion of enterprise scale, a virtual private network (VPN) has spanned a large number of administrative domains, so effective management of inter-domain traffic is urgently demanded. This paper presents the simplest step called as BGP-based inter-domain TE. The method is on the basis of various border gateway protocol (BGP) attributes, BGP policy and autonomous system (AS) relationship. To implement TE, the method applies diverse routing policies by configured BGP attributes to control the outgoing and incoming traffic in an AS. We ensure that the best route in an AS depends on the routes coming from its neighboring ASes that apply export policies, as well as the import policies of the AS. Simulation shows that our approach can effectively implement inter-domain TE in BGP/MPLS VPNs.

[1]  Lixin Gao,et al.  The extent of AS path inflation by routing policies , 2002, Global Telecommunications Conference, 2002. GLOBECOM '02. IEEE.

[2]  G. Huston,et al.  Interconnection, Peering and Settlements , 2003 .

[3]  Lixin Gao On inferring autonomous system relationships in the internet , 2001, TNET.

[4]  Lixin Gao,et al.  On inferring autonomous system relationships in the Internet , 2000, Globecom '00 - IEEE. Global Telecommunications Conference. Conference Record (Cat. No.00CH37137).

[5]  Bassam Halabi,et al.  Internet Routing Architectures , 1997 .

[6]  Evi Nemeth,et al.  Internet expansion, refinement and churn , 2002, Eur. Trans. Telecommun..